?After a short vacation I am back in the shack.
I changed the IRFZ24's with a new set, adjusted bias and was ready to test.
CW first with a dummy load. Output looked good on the scope. Output 25W on 20m with 2tone signal. Began flattopping with more power. Maybe my powersupply is too small.
Then I tried sending some letters from the keyboard. The very first dot or dash was never sent. So A became T, K became A, etc.
The K3NG mod seems to fix the keyboard cw-problem.
Then I connected a paddle. There is a timing problem too with a paddle. A short press on the can result in a very short dit or dash. Again the polling frequency is the problem. (There is something called interrupts)
Then I switched to FT8.
First issue: there is no way to turn the volume down. The T41-SDT book placed over the speaker solved this :-)
In the FT8-demo video Ashar showed how easy a qso can be. But the current software does not work that way. I tried several times and when someone answered my CQ the next steps for a QSO didn't happen.
Then for calling CQ you have to press the CQ-button (F5) for every period instead of calling CQ several times and waiting for an answer.
